According to CBBreference, CJ grabbed a higher percentage of defensive boards than Fab in 2012 and a higher percentage than Rak in 2013. Jerami Grant grabbed a higher percentage of defensive boards than Rak in 2014. Lydon's 18% defensive rebounding rate is the highest for any Syracuse player with this many minutes since Rick Jackson in 2011 20%.
